Output e07a440515c035fdf1c933e78de7f6efdc366b07473ce7852373944d95504970:0

value
2639260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ebc25fe904ea371fe082851d54e6fed2154b256 OP_EQUAL
address
3GAL5djDcfH84TjgCd6uwpuBX4aQfQifVm
transaction
e07a440515c035fdf1c933e78de7f6efdc366b07473ce7852373944d95504970
confirmations
354470
spent
true